Growing: Set It and Forget It (Mostly)
Seed to harvest in 70–85 days, which is roughly the same length as your last situationship. Plants stay compact (60–90 cm), perfect for tents, balconies, or that closet you told your landlord was for shoes. She’ll forgive light nute burn, minor temp swings, and your questionable playlist choices. Expect golf-ball nugs glazed like Amsterdam's finest donuts—just don’t dunk them in coffee.
